11" x 14" Mixed Media on Watercolor Paper
This page looks to be telling the of creation and/or some kind of travel and ritual. At first glance it appears that it is a ritual involving fertilization and perhaps astral or time travel.
11" x 14" Mixed Media on Watercolor Paper